-
Notifications
You must be signed in to change notification settings - Fork 0
자바 스터디 깃 활용법
honamgyu edited this page Apr 10, 2016
·
17 revisions
#이슈
##작성 목적
어떤 문제를 해결하거나 프로젝트를 시작할 때 진행을 가속화하기 위해 공지를 하고 효과적인 진행 방법을 토론하고자 할 때 이슈를 사용합니다! 프로젝트 진행을 굳이 이슈를 사용하면서 메일함을 늘릴 필요는 없어요!
##Deadline
- 이슈에 관해서 꼭 지켜져야 할 마감일이 있을 때 써주세요.
- 단순 희망 날짜는 자제해주세요.
- "비현실적 날짜 - 안 지켜짐" 루프 주의 #deadloop
##Afterlife
- 마감일이 지켜지지 않았을 때 어떻게 할지 아이디어가 있으면 써주세요.
- 빠른 진행을 위한 위협으로 사용하면 (안)됩니다.
##Labels
- 이슈 종류를 구분할 때 사용합니다!
- 간단한 질문은 개인적으로 해주세요 #issue_overflow
- 다음과 같은 이슈들이 있습니다.
- new Project(): 새로운 프로젝트를 시작할 때
- new Event(): 새로운 이벤트를 시작할 때
- new Issue(): 중요한 문제가 생겼을 때
- new Idea(): 프로젝트 또는 새로운 이벤트를 요청 할 때
- requestWiki(): 위키의 작성 / 수정을 요청할 때
- issue.issue(): 이슈 작성법 등의 형식적인 부분에 문제가 있을 때
- Hey World!: 쫌 중요한 공유거리 예시
- new Idea()가 결정되면 이슈가 닫히고 새로운 new Project/Event()가 열리는 형태입니다.
##Assignee
- 이슈와 관련된 주요 인물들을 지정할 때 사용합니다.
##부모/자식 이슈
- 이슈 작성 목적과 어긋나기 때문에 자제하는걸로~
##기타 형식
- 형식은 자유지만 아래와 같은 형식이 적당할 것 같습니다.
- 설명
- 해결해야 할 문제
- (소환)
- (Deadline)
- (Afterlife)
- 저처럼 형식에 너무 신경을 쓰진 말아주세요!
#위키 어떤 일이 너무 커져서 눈팅족이 따라가기 힘들 땐 위키를 사용해서 한 눈에 알기 쉽게 정리를 해줍시다. @짐전
##남슈의 이규 철학
아직 많은 사람들이 깃허브에 익숙해지지 않은 상황에서, 소스 코드 관리가 필요 없는 프로젝트를 관리하는데 카톡을 두고 굳이 깃허브를 써야 할 필요는 없는 것 같습니다. 다만, 카톡에서는 중요한 일이 짤에 묻히고 정리가 안되는 상황이 빈번하게 발생하니, 프로젝트를 시작하거나 상황을 정리할 때에 한해서 깃허브를 효율적으로 사용할 수 있도록 위와 같은 깃 활용법을 정했어요~ 자바 스터디 깃허브는 위와 같은 방향으로 사용해주세요!
또한 불필요한 형식과 관리를 최소화하기 위해 부모 이슈, 자식 이슈, 마일스톤 등 큰 필요성이 없는 부분은 생략했어요~ 물론, 필요성이 느껴진다면 issue.issue() issue를 써주세요!